[dovecot-cvs] dovecot/src/pop3 mail-storage-callbacks.c,1.4,1.5

cras at procontrol.fi cras at procontrol.fi
Tue May 25 20:50:38 EEST 2004


Update of /home/cvs/dovecot/src/pop3
In directory talvi:/tmp/cvs-serv15205/pop3

Modified Files:
	mail-storage-callbacks.c 
Log Message:
Send recent counter changes when it actually changes.



Index: mail-storage-callbacks.c
===================================================================
RCS file: /home/cvs/dovecot/src/pop3/mail-storage-callbacks.c,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-d -r1.4 -r1.5
--- a/mail-storage-callbacks.c	2 May 2004 20:32:16 -0000	1.4
+++ b/mail-storage-callbacks.c	25 May 2004 17:50:36 -0000	1.5
@@ -59,13 +59,19 @@
 {
 }
 
-static void new_messages(struct mailbox *mailbox __attr_unused__,
-			 unsigned int messages_count __attr_unused__,
-			 unsigned int recent_count __attr_unused__,
-			 void *context __attr_unused__)
+static void message_count_changed(struct mailbox *mailbox __attr_unused__,
+				  unsigned int count __attr_unused__,
+				  void *context __attr_unused__)
 {
 }
 
+static void recent_count_changed(struct mailbox *mailbox __attr_unused__,
+				 unsigned int count __attr_unused__,
+				 void *context __attr_unused__)
+{
+}
+
+
 static void new_keywords(struct mailbox *mailbox __attr_unused__,
 			 const char *keywords[] __attr_unused__,
 			 unsigned int keywords_count __attr_unused__,
@@ -79,6 +85,7 @@
 	notify_no,
 	expunge,
 	update_flags,
-	new_messages,
+	message_count_changed,
+	recent_count_changed,
 	new_keywords
 };



More information about the dovecot-cvs mailing list